Exhibit 1 - Agenda Information Sheet City of Denton _____________________________________________________________________________________ AGENDA INFORMATION SHEET DEPARTMENT: Procurement & Compliance ACM: David Gaines DATE: January 25, 2022 SUBJECT Consider adoption of an ordinance of the City of Denton, a Texas home-rule municipal corporation, authorizing the City Manager to execute a contract with North Texas Umpire Association, for the supply of certified softball officiating services for the Parks and Recreation Department; providing for the expenditure of funds therefor; and providing an effective date (IFB 7851 – awarded to North Texas Umpire Association, for one (1) year, with the option for two (2) additional one (1) year extensions, in the total three (3) year not-to-exceed amount of $150,000.00). INFORMATION/BACKGROUND The Adult Softball league is operated by the Parks and Recreation Department (PARD) staff and is offered in the spring, summer, and fall seasons. Under the proposed contract, North Texas Umpire Association (NTUA) will be scheduled to officiate approximately 850 softball games for PARD during the 2021-2022 fiscal year. NTUA will provide officials and scorekeepers for the PARD Adult Softball Leagues that will be sanctioned by the USA Softball rules/governing body. Services Estimated Expenditure Year 1 (estimated 850 games at $58 a game) $ 50,000 Year 2 (estimated 850 games at $58 a game) $ 50,000 Year 3 (estimated 850 games at $58 a game) $ 50,000 Total $150,000 Invitation for Bids was sent to 397 prospective suppliers of this item. In addition, specifications were placed on the Procurement and Compliance website for prospective suppliers to download and advertised in the local newspaper. One (1) bid was received, and references were checked to ensure the vendor can provide the services requested in the Scope of Work. PRINCIPAL PLACE OF BUSINESS North Texas Umpire Association (NTUA) Denton, TX ESTIMATED SCHEDULE OF PROJECT This is an initial one (1) year contract with options to extend the contract for two (2) additional one (1) year periods, with all terms and conditions remaining the same. FISCAL INFORMATION These services will be funded from Parks and Recreation Operating Funds. The City will only pay for services rendered and is not obligated to pay the full contract amount unless needed.
